使用root访问自我更新android系统应用程序

时间:2014-01-27 23:58:24

标签: android apk android-install-apk rom automatic-updates

我已经从aosp创建了自定义ROM。我还包括了我的应用程序,让我们在构建时在自定义ROM中调用myCustomInstaller.apk(1.0)。该应用程序基本上是一种Google Play商店。该应用程序具有系统权限,可以静默安装或删除应用程序。

我可以安装,更新或删除任何其他应用程序。我面临的问题是,当我将myCustomInstaller.apk更新为2.0本身时,应用程序也会以静默方式安装,我能够看到安装的应用程序中安装的最新版本,但是当我重新启动时手机,myCustomInstaller应用程序恢复原始版本。

我真的不知道如何继续,google playstore如何更新自己,以及安装其他应用程序?我是否需要任何其他权限才能使myCustomInstaller应用的更新版本保持不变?

我正在使用它进行静默安装,是的,我修改了代码以进行更新和删除 https://code.google.com/p/auto-update-apk-client/

1 个答案:

答案 0 :(得分:5)

你确定在你的Manifest中增加了android:versionCode吗?如果没有,则在启动时将删除仅存储在/ data /目录中的更新版本。